The Alpine A290 (Hatchback) is powered by a Electric engine and comes with a Automatic transmission. In comparison, the GWM ORA 03 (Hatchback) features a Electric engine and a Automatic gearbox.
When it comes to boot capacity, the Alpine A290 offers 326 L, while the GWM ORA 03 provides 228 L – depending on what matters most to you. If you’re looking for more power, you’ll need to decide whether the 218 HP of the Alpine A290 or the 171 HP of the GWM ORA 03 suits your needs better.
There are also differences in efficiency: 15.90 kWh vs 16.50 kWh. In terms of price, the Alpine A290 starts at 33200 £, while the GWM ORA 03 is available from 33400 £.

The Alpine A290 marks a significant step forward in the automotive realm, presenting a compelling blend of sportiness, innovation, and eco-friendliness. As one of the latest entries into the electric vehicle market, it showcases Alpine's commitment to pushing boundaries and redefining performance.
Under the sleek exterior of the A290 lies an advanced electric powertrain, available in various configurations that produce between 177 and 218 PS. This impressive power output allows for exhilarating acceleration, with 0-100 km/h times ranging from just 6.4 to 7.4 seconds. The A290 not only promises thrilling performance but also offers a respectable top speed of up to 170 km/h, catering to driving enthusiasts looking for excitement.
Efficiency is at the forefront of the A290's design, boasting a consumption rate that falls between 15.9 and 16.6 kWh per 100 km. The vehicle can achieve an electric range of up to 378 km, making it a practical choice for both daily commutes and longer journeys. This balance of performance and efficiency demonstrates Alpine's dedication to crafting a vehicle that excels in every aspect.
The Alpine A290 is equipped with a cutting-edge automated transmission featuring a reduction gearbox, which enhances driving dynamics while promoting energy efficiency. The vehicle's CO2 efficiency class is rated at 'A', reflecting its eco-friendly credentials. Additionally, with a spacious interior catering for up to five passengers and a boot capacity of 326 litres, the A290 strikes a fine balance between sportiness and practicality.
With a length of 3997 mm, a width of 1823 mm, and a height of 1512 mm, the A290 boasts a compact yet assertive presence on the road. Its sporty hatchback design is accentuated by aggressive lines and aerodynamic curves, embodying the essence of Alpine’s racing heritage while remaining sophisticated for everyday use. The car's lightweight structure, tipping the scales at just 1479 kg, contributes to its excellent handling and agility.
The A290 offers an array of trim levels (including GT, GT Performance, GT Premium, and GTS), allowing buyers to tailor their vehicles to their specific desires and lifestyle needs. Each variant comes packed with advanced technologies and premium materials, ensuring that every journey is comfortable and engaging.
Starting at approximately €38,700 and going up to €46,200, the Alpine A290 provides a compelling entry point into the world of high-performance electric vehicles. The automotive industry’s electrification wave rolls on, adding a new player to the mix – the GWM ORA 03. With its intriguing blend of style, power, and technology, this all-electric hatchback promises to be a compelling choice for eco-conscious motorists. Let's delve deeper into what sets the ORA 03 apart from the competition.
The GWM ORA 03 exhibits a sleek and modern design, well-suited for urban environments. It measures between 4,235mm and 4,254mm in length, with a width ranging from 1,825mm to 1,848mm, and a height of 1,603mm, making it compact yet spacious enough for a family-friendly journey.
At the heart of the ORA 03 is an electric motor generating 126 kW (171 PS) of power, delivering a solid 250 Nm of torque. This front-wheel-drive vehicle boasts an impressive acceleration, reaching 0-100 km/h in just 8.2 to 8.3 seconds. Its top speed maxes out at 160 km/h, offering excitement while maintaining efficiency.
The ORA 03 comes equipped with a battery capacity ranging from 45.4 kWh to 59.3 kWh. This electric hatchback promises impressive efficiencies, with a consumption of 16.5 to 16.8 kWh per 100 km and delivers a zero-emission driving range between 310 km and 420 km, depending on the battery size. This makes it ideal for both city commutes and longer journeys.
Inside, the GWM ORA 03 offers a well-arranged interior with seating for five. Despite its compact exterior, the car provides a comfortable ride for all occupants. The boot space stands at 228 litres, adequate for everyday use, and further enhanced by the practicality of its five-door design.
The ORA 03 is equipped with advanced technological features, ensuring safety and convenience. It boasts a state-of-the-art infotainment system, comprehensive driver-assistance technologies, and various driving modes tailored to different conditions. Available in several trim levels, including 300, 300 Pro, and GT, it offers different levels of luxury and capability.
With a price tag between €38,990 and €49,490, the GWM ORA 03 is competitively priced in the electric vehicle market. Beyond the purchase cost, it offers low running expenses due to its zero emissions and classification under CO2 efficiency class A, making it a responsible choice for environmentally concerned drivers.
